The Electric Ducted Fan.

 

EDF Jets. The RC Lander ducted fan.

The unit shown here is manufactured by RC Lander ( It is used in the Hunter shown above) and is available from NITROPLANES.com

This unit is 68 mm (2.67inches) diameter and incorporates a 5 bladed fan. RPM can be as high as 47,000 with a maximum thrust of 1.6 kg(3.52lb)

The material used in the construction is primarily aluminum alloy

These numbers are typical of what today's technology can offer and many jets and ducted fan units are available.

The RC Lander Hawker Hunter.

We can use the Hunter as an example of a modern jet model.

This hunter has a wing span of 41.3" and the total finished weight should be no more than 39oz.

Did you notice that the Hunter is a 6-channel,scale model, complete with flaps and retractable landing gear!

Even at its maximum weight the thrust to weight ratio is greater than 1, which guarantees a spirited performance.

 

The use of Li-Po batteries and brushless motors, along with perfected ducted fan technology, has made this type of model practical and not that expensive.

BVM Jets and Electric Power.

Bob Violett Models has a very large range of all types of jets. These are all large models, usually constructed of fiberglass and incorporate the latest technologies.
